About This Item

[Caen]: [Chalopin], [ca. 1800]. Very Good. 12mo (137 x 84 mm). 12 pp. Signatures: A\4, B\2. Stab-sewn with binder's thread in original blue plain wrappers. Reference: René Helot, La Bibliothèque bleue en Normandie (1928), p. 245.

The text is a reduction of Vulson’s 1660 original, which included a prose gloss and went on for 96 pages. The text is unchanged, there is just less of it. We learn, for instance, that if you dream that you are a tree, it means you are sick. If you dream that your teeth are longer than they really are, it means that your relatives are bothering you. Dreams of flying are a great honor. Dreaming of a beautiful person”qui aura la tête & le visage très beau” (with a beautiful head and face) means you will have joy, happiness and health. Yet it adds one important factor for popular consumption: not only does it explain the symbolism of your dreams, but it also publishes the most frequently drawn numbers in the Loterie Nationale. (Who hasn’t dreamed of winning the lottery?) A rare document of popular credence and of the force of symbolism in popular culture. OCLC locates the Newberry and BnF copies only.
